  • Abstract
    Ad Hoc workflow is a workflow system which does not need to define the predefined workflow business process and organize migrating workflow union. In this case a single work place is unable to get the full system information, and the ability of the single work place in the system for goal decomposition and service understanding is limited. Some goals which can be completed by Ad Hoc Workflow System may be unknown for a certain work place. This paper focusing on the problem of Ad Hoc workflows goal planning for the unknown goal, presents a planning method of the unknown goal in Mobile Agent migration process. The method describes goals with Dynamic Description Logic, packages the unknown goal, and achieves dynamic goal planning. Goal Description, Goal Inference and methods and algorithms of dynamic goal planning are mentioned in this paper.
